Direct (nonstop) flights from Newcastle to Malaga
3 airlines fly nonstop from Newcastle International Airport (NCL) to Málaga Airport (AGP). It's 1,274 miles (2,051 km), about 3h 15m in the air. Operated by Ryanair, Jet2, easyJet.

How long is the direct flight from Newcastle to Malaga?
A nonstop flight from Newcastle (NCL) to Malaga (AGP) takes approximately 3 hours and 15 minutes. The distance is 1,274 miles (2,051 km).
Which airlines fly nonstop from Newcastle to Malaga?
3 airlines: Ryanair, Jet2, easyJet.
Is there a nonstop flight from Newcastle to Malaga?
Yes. 3 airlines: Ryanair, Jet2, easyJet.
How far is Newcastle from Malaga?
The flight distance from Newcastle to Malaga is 1,274 miles (2,051 km), measured as the great-circle (shortest air) distance. That's roughly the same distance as New York to Miami.
